Miss Mary has been a special education teacher for over 20 years. She began as a First Grade teacher while working on her graduatedegrees in special education and administration.  She loves herstudents.  And teachers always refer to their students as "theirkids!"  

The special education DCD students are from kindergarden to grade 6.

In the special education room many functional skills are practiceddaily from kindergarten to 6th grade (depending on the skill andability level of each student).  Such as: calendar, cooking,cleaning, self care, helping younger students, jobs, responsibility forbelongings, and independence.
